WebCounty death records have been inventoried through 1920. Access to death records is restricted for 50 years following the date of death by Oregon Administrative Rule 333-011-0096. Contact the Oregon State Archives for access to state death certificates that are more than 50 years old. WebOJCIN Online. OJCIN is the Oregon Judicial Case Information Network.
